Summary: | Cap belonging to Daniel O'Connell, M.P., (1775-1847). It was used as evidence in the Irish State Trials of 1844. |

Notes: | Illustration from "Illustrated London News", 17th February, 1844. Text printed l.c.: The above drawing represents the velvet cap and green tassell, presented to O'Connell at the Mullaghmast meeting, and which has since taken the shape of a crown in the vivid imaginations of the Attorney and Solicitor Generals...
